Description
High-quality adhesive and sealing compound, specially formulated for use in both industrial and automotive settings.
- With exceptional resistance to chemicals, including engine oil, transmission oil, refrigerant, and anti-freeze agents, it’s perfect for critical areas requiring contact with various liquids.
- Featuring a non-acidic hardening system, this compound won’t corrode electronic components or lambda probes.
- Packaged in a convenient compressed-air can, it’s easy to dispense without additional aids, ensuring uniform application with fine beads.
- For optimal results, ensure surfaces are dry, clean, and dust-free before application, and remove any old sealant completely.

Colour | Black |
Contents | 200 ml |
Chemical basis | Neutral crosslinked silicones, oxime-based |
Smell/fragrance | Characteristic |
Min./max. temperature resistance | -60 to 260 °C |
Max. short-term temperature resistance | 300 °C |
Range of applications | Water pumps Oil pumps Front cover Camshaft bearing cover Thermostat housing Oil pans Transmission cover Sunroof Doors |
Density | 1.25 g/cm³ |
Min. skin-formation time | 5 min |
Conditions for skin-formation time | at 23°C and 50% relative humidity |
Full curing speed | 3 mm/d |
Fully hardening/curing conditions | 23°C and 50% relative humidity |
Shore A hardness | 30 |
Min. tensile strength | 2.2 N/mm² |
Conditions for tensile strength | in accordance with ASTM D-412 |
Max. breaking elongation/conditions | 550 % / in accordance with DIN 53504 |
Heat conductance λ | 0.2 J/(m*s*K) |
Heat conductance λ conditions | in accordance with ASTM D-2214/70 |
Coefficient of thermal expansion | 0.0002 1/K |
Coefficient of thermal expansion conditions | in accordance with ASTM EB-31 |
Dielectric strength | 16 kV/mm |
Dielectric strength conditions | in accordance with ASTM D-149 |
Relative permittivity | 2.8 |
Conditions for relative permittivity | 1 MHz, ASTM D-150 |
Loss factor | 0.002 |
Loss factor conditions | 1 MHz, ASTM D-150 |
Specific volume resistivity | 1000000000000000 Ohm/cm |
Conditions for specific volume resistivity | in accordance with ASTM D-257 |
